Outsource Your I.T

I.T services can be expensive to both purchase in the first place, and sometimes even more to maintain. It’s very much worth considering to outsource your I.T to a specialist company to avoid all the hassle and expenses of running your own system. A lot of business are opting for cloud computing services these days. The advantage of this is that you simply need to get hold of fairly basic, and cheap, hardware. However, you are still able to make use of the power of an external, remote server. I.T outsourcing is certainly growing in popularity, too. Your choice of company is important, however. Make sure that you invest in your I.T system with a business that understands your SME’s needs. You don’t want to be paying for a package or services that are unnecessary for your company. The best I.T outsourcing companies will offer an on the job 24/7 helpdesk and be proactive in their maintenance of your network. Anything less simply won’t do! Outsourcing your I.T makes sense. This is because although it still costs a fair whack, you’re saving so much money by not having to employ a team of I.T specialists. Plus, you save additional funds on hardware, too. This could easily be spent elsewhere. There’s also the element of time you save by not having to fix your own computers when they go wrong, thankfully, now, that is somebody else’s job!

Host International Meetings Remotely

This one could save you an absolute fortune. If your business regularly deals with international clients from overseas, then you need to change the way you go about meeting them. Instead of expensive around the world flights and costly nightly hotel rates, simply give them a call over Skype. Arrange a time, set up a professional looking conference room and discuss exactly what needs to be spoken about over the internet – for free! Be wary, however, some cultures may find it offensive that you are not willing to meet them to do business. However, in most cases this is going to be largely welcomed and accepted. You’re also saving your client money on their travelling expenses too, remember. This will save you both a ton of cash, and a massive chunk of time that would have been spent commuting.

Retain Your Best Employees

Finally, this may seem somewhat counterintuitive, but it is important. Rewarding your best employees and encouraging them to have illustrious careers with you is going to save you time and money down the line. While offering a member of staff a bonus might not seem like you’re cutting back on money, you are, however, doing yourself a favour. If you stick with your best staff, then your business is more likely to flourish and grow. However, more importantly, you won’t be faced with the costs of re-staffing and hiring somebody new should they leave. Not only does this cost a lot of money to do, but it also takes up a whole lot of your time that you could be better spent elsewhere.
